Transaction 2a30f5b2fc907566f828bb755ce517168c70f59cdb484a0aaa6c1183addcdf97

3 Input
1 Outputs
  • 2a30f5b2fc907566f828bb755ce517168c70f59cdb484a0aaa6c1183addcdf97:0
  • value  39497576
    address  17syVzj9gT9osgju8jT64PHJwLPkx6EwMZ